Just scored for the U23 against Swansea which West Ham are cruising 2-0 by the time I am typing this in 35th minutes and Alese who scored a "Messi" goal as he drives past one or two attackers near the halfway line.... then two midfielders... then brushes off another challenge with his shoulder... he's through on goal and on the slide pokes it into the bottom corner!

He would be a good defender for us as he is doing very well in U23 and that could answer the problem for Ogbonna but not sure if he do left foot.
